Chapter Twenty-four

I could heard the monitor beeping as I opened my eyes.

Beep......beep......beep.

The rhythm was steady at first, my surroundings coming into focus.

Beep....beep....beep.

It was getting faster as air filled my lungs and my heart started beating faster. The sound was almost deafening in my roaring ears.

Beep..beep..beep.

As I sat up in my bad, hospital clothes hanging on me in a baggy fashion, I saw nurses tending to the bed beside me. There was so much commotion.

Did I really wake up? Hadn't Reid's boss wanted me dead? I tried to focus. But all I kept hearing was that stupid noise.

Beep.beep.beep.

There was a tube attached to my arm. Without thinking, I pulled it out and the beeping turned into a loud squeal that caused me to cover my ears with my hands. I couldn't take it anymore. I needed to hear something else or I was going to go crazy.

A large breath was taken at the bed beside me, the nurses and one doctor finally backing up and then realizing I was here too. "She's awake." The doctor said, followed by nurses holding me down and sticking the tube back into my arm.

But not before I saw John give me a small smile before he fell back against his bed.

Okay, I could definitely deal with the sound of John breathing.

❒❒❒❒

There were tests being run, both mine and John's family being forced to stay on the other side of the looking glass to our room. It had been two hours now and all me and John were allowed to do was talk to each other, and only as long as we spoke loud enough for the doctor to hear us.

But I said nothing to John. There was only one reason why they would want us to speak under the circumstances we were in, they wanted information. I assumed John wasn't saying anything to me for the same reason.

Plus, we were told someone important was coming to speak with us.

But, of course, I tried to be rebellious. "I want to see my family. You can't keep us locked up in here."

"You'll see them shortly," Was all the doctor kept saying. "Wait until your visitors get here. They should be arriving soon."

"You said that an hour-" John started but was quickly shut up.

"Enough, both of you." We both stopped talking after that, leaving me to stare at the scenery around me yet again out of pure boredom. 

The walls were a cream color, pictures of lighthouses and flowers and other calming crap hanging on the wall. Machines were everywhere and I was still hooked up to my tube, something I recently learned was taking blood.

I was angry. I didn't deserve this.

It had been five minutes later and I was about the bug the guy again, but then I saw her; Natalie. 

She rushed up to the glass and placed her hands there, making me practically jump off the bed. And I would have, had I not been stuck there. 

I did what I had to. I screamed. "Natalie, help us. They won't let us go."

She was screaming too, I could hear it, but it was muffled a minute later by a hand cupping around head mouth and shutting her up.

The next minute, our visitors arrived. But they didn't come in. I saw the Doctor leave the room, me and John left alone.

"Okay, we have to get out of here." John say immediately. "Because I don't know who exactly these visitors are, but I don't have a good feeling about them either."

"Nice to see we're on the same page." I told him. "I'm glad you're okay."

He raised his eyebrow. "Why wouldn't I be? We woke up, we're both going to be okay."

"It's uh -it's nothing. I'll tell you later." I replied, deciding it was best to tell his about my dream leading out of the test later when there was no one possibly listening in. And good thing to, because right then the doors opened.

I heard the sound of boots, heavy boots, and watched as multiple men flooded the room, me covering myself even more in my hospital gown with my blankets. 

There was a woman next, dark skin and darker hair. She didn't smile or try to convince us we could trust her. Instead, she lifted her head and spoke, "Give them something to change into. I would like to speak with them appropriately." And then she walked out again.

My mind raced for many reasons. One, this person might be Reid's boss, which kinda changed my theory on Mary a bit. Two, if this was the boss, these people are definitely not ones I wish to be around.

For that reason, I wished that Mary was the boss.

A second later, me and John were each handed clothes to wear. Them handed to me with a quick, "Sorry if they're too big." As they were given to me.

They unhooked the tube and escorted me to a bathroom to my left so I could change. The clothes consisted of black, baggy pants that hung real loosely around my waist. And if it wasn't for the long, overpowering grey shirt that was with it, my underwear would have definitely been seen. Luckily, a bra was provided too, me slipping it on quickly along with a pair of shoes they had offered.

Once I exited, there were men already waiting there for me, making sure I wouldn't escape. From there, I was led out.

My brother lunged the second I was out, but he was pushed back. "Lexi, oh my god, what's going on?"

My was in hysterics too, and dad just stared at me. Mary was no where to be found.

John was next to exit, his mom punching one of the guys and actually able to get a hug. "Oh, my poor baby. Why didn't you listen to me, I told you no." She said it kinda in a whisper, but I could hear it. 

But that's when a gun came out of a guy's pocket and she was pulled away by her husband.

Natalie stand in the background, not saying a word but smiling slightly. She was letting me know I did good.

"If you make one more move, any of you, I will not hesitate to use this." Said the guy with the gun. "Now, everyone, follow me. These teens are to stay up front. You guys guard and watch the others." He directed.

At that we all walked away from that spot.

It was a total of fifteen minutes of silence before we made our way to another room. It was bigger than the one I was previously in, me turning to John and silently questioning what we were doing here.

The woman stood near one of the hospital beds, papers sprawled out across it. "Please, come in." She said, not smiling as she hadn't before. "I have much to ask each of you."

There were chairs lining the floor and we each took a seat, me in the first and beside John. Natalie was fortunate enough to get the next one.

"You may leave." She told the men, at which they did. "I'm sure you're all wondering what's going on here. Please, voice your opinion."

I heard my dad speak up, causing me to sigh loudly. "Our daughter just came out of a coma. Again. What in the world could she have possibly done? Or the other one for that matter?" I'm sure not just me bit their lip when he said it.

"Why don't you ask her, Mr. James?" She then smiled, it was strange. She then turned back to me. "It would be a lot easier for both of you if you just cooperated and told us everything you know."

"I don't know what you're talking about," John spoke up. 

She leaned down to him, right in front of his face. "I have something that'll help you figure it out." She tilted her head to Natalie. "Ms. Daniels, please inform him of how this is so."

My eyes shot open further at her next words. "They have Annie."

"Yes," The woman said. "We do. And we will do anything it takes to get both of you to talk. Not to mention, we know of a certain teenage boy locked in jail right now that we can use too. I'm sure he would just love to hear that your unwillingness to help us resulted in the pain and agony that he's about to feel. Just wait a second, i'll bring one of those men back in here and tell them to-"

"Stop," I whimpered. I looked up at her. "Please don't hurt him. He's been hurt enough."

She brought a chair over, sitting in front of me. "Then talk."
